(1) Juvenile parole services are administered by the division of youth services in the department of human services, under the direction of the director of the division of youth services, appointed pursuant to section 19-2.5-1501.
(2) The director of the division shall appoint juvenile parole officers and other personnel of the division of youth services pursuant to section 13 of article XII of the state constitution and with the consent of the department of human services. Juvenile parole officers have the powers and duties specified in section 19-2.5-1204 and the powers of peace officers, as described in sections 16-2.5-101 and 16-2.5-138.
(3) The division of youth services may divide juvenile parole supervision into regions throughout the state. Within each region there may be more than one office location for parole officers.
